Green tech quietly rewires daily life in Boston, from solar panels to smart grids
How local residents are seeing energy costs drop, air quality improve, and new software jobs emerge as climate-friendly technology moves out of labs and into homes.

BOSTON, On a hot July morning in the Back Bay, a residential solar array on a brownstone roof sent surplus power back into the grid, trimming the homeowner's monthly electricity bill by 17 percent. Three miles south, in a Jamaica Plain basement, a smart water heater synced with a real-time carbon-intensity signal to run only when low-carbon power dominated the regional mix.
These are not pilot projects. They are everyday scenes in a city where green technology has quietly become part of the infrastructure of daily life.
The shift matters now because Boston is racing to meet its own Carbon Free Boston goal, a 50 percent reduction in greenhouse-gas emissions by 2030, relative to 2005 levels, while simultaneously absorbing a population that grew by more than 9 percent in the last decade. The city's energy use per capita has been dropping, but the absolute demand keeps rising. Green tech, in short, is no longer a niche: It is a necessity for keeping the lights on and the air breathable.
From smart meters to shared e-bikes
Eversource, the regional utility, has now installed more than 100,000 advanced smart meters across its Massachusetts service territory, according to company filings with the Department of Public Utilities. The meters let residents see their electricity consumption in 15-minute increments rather than waiting for a monthly bill. In Dorchester, users of a city-backed community-choice aggregation program have seen average annual savings of roughly $180 since the program launched in 2019.
Boston's Bluebikes bike-share system, which added 120 electric-assist bikes this spring, logged more than 2.1 million trips in 2025, up from 1.4 million in 2021. The e-bikes, which flatten the city's notoriously hilly terrain, now account for 38 percent of all Bluebikes rides, according to data published by the Metropolitan Area Planning Council.
Air quality and the hidden payoff
The health benefits are harder to measure per household but increasingly visible. A 2025 study by the Boston University School of Public Health, using air-quality sensors deployed across the city, found that neighborhoods with the highest concentration of electric-vehicle charging stations, notably the South End, Fenway, and parts of Cambridge, saw a 12 percent greater reduction in nitrogen-dioxide levels between 2020 and 2025 compared with neighborhoods with few chargers.
In Allston, the local community group Allston Brighton Green planted 90 new trees this spring as part of a green-infrastructure grant from the state's Executive Office of Energy and Environmental Affairs. The trees catch stormwater and shade homes, lowering summer cooling costs. The group says it has seen a 30 percent increase in participation at its monthly workshops since last year.
The job market is shifting in tandem. The Boston Green Jobs Coalition, a nonprofit that trains residents for clean-energy roles, reported placing 340 people into full-time positions in 2025, solar installers, energy auditors, and smart-grid technicians, up from 210 in 2023.
What comes next for Bostonians
The city's Building Emissions Reduction and Disclosure Ordinance, passed in 2019, will require all buildings larger than 35,000 square feet to meet emissions limits starting in 2027. That means thousands of apartments, offices, and shops will need efficiency upgrades, insulation, heat pumps, smart controls, or face fines. The Residential Assistance in Building Electrification program, funded by a $1.5 million state grant, has already helped 680 low- and moderate-income households in Boston install heat pumps and induction stoves.
For residents not yet touched by these programs, the immediate practical step is straightforward: check whether your building is covered under the BERDO rules, and if you own a home, look into the city's Solar Boston program, which offers free technical assistance and a streamlined permitting process.
